Financial Review
 
Origin Enterprises plc (‘Origin’ or ‘the Group’), announces a 74 per cent increase in comparable adjusted fully diluted earnings per share** for the year ending 31 July 2008 to 34.05c compared to 19.63c in the previous year. Profit before financing costs* for the financial year increased by 75 per cent to €73.2 million.
 
Revenue
 
Group revenue was 69 per cent higher at €1.5 billion with underlying revenue growth excluding the impact of acquisitions of 26 per cent. 
 
The Agri-Nutrition businesses achieved revenues of €1.17 billion, an increase of 80 per cent. Underlying revenue growth excluding the impact of acquisitions was 34 per cent. The Food businesses recorded revenue growth of 40 per cent to €339 million. Excluding the impact of the Odlums acquisition underlying revenue growth was 6 per cent.
 
Operating profit
 
Group operating profit* increased by 86 per cent to €70.9 million with underlying growth in operating profit excluding acquisitions of 42 per cent. 
 
Operating profit* from the Agri-Nutrition businesses increased by 99 per cent to €55.0 million. Excluding the impact of acquisitions, operating profit from the Agri-Nutrition businesses grew by 55 per cent. Operating profit* from the Food businesses increased by 52 per cent to €15.9 million. Excluding the impact of acquisitions, operating profit* increased by 6 per cent.
 
Associates
 
Following the acquisition of the controlling interest in Odlums in August 2007, Origin’s associate investment in the year under review primarily consisted of the 50 per cent interest in the animal feed manufacturer John Thompson and Sons Ltd, which delivered a satisfactory performance during the year.
 
Finance Costs
 
Net finance costs amounted to €14.6 million and are covered 5.6 times by EBITDA.
 
Net cashflow from operating activities
 
Net cashflow from operating activities increased by 66 per cent to €74.6 million, attributable to a strong underlying performance across the businesses and focussed cash management against the backdrop of significant increases in commodity prices.
 
 
 
Balance Sheet
 
Net debt at 31 July 2008 was €175.1 million compared with €71.7 million at the end of the previous year. This represents an excellent performance after a capital expenditure and acquisition spend of €179.0 million. 
 
Dividend
 
As previously outlined no dividend will be paid in respect of the year ended 31 July 2008. The Board will review its dividend policy in advance of the announcement of its Interim Results in March 2009.

Agri-Nutrition comprises agri-inputs (feed ingredients and fertiliser blending and distribution), integrated on-farm agronomy and marine proteins and oils (fishmeal and fish oil manufacturing and distribution). These businesses provide customised solutions that address the efficiency, quality and output requirements of primary food producers.
 
Security of global food supply is placing an increasing emphasis on systems and technologies underpinning primary food production. This new focus is multi faceted comprising efficient input sourcing, prescriptive farming systems, yield enhancement technologies and the identification of regions with well situated productive soils capable of large scale efficient production. 
 
The Group has made significant progress during 2008 in the development of its Agri-Nutrition businesses through acquisition and capital investment. We now have an extended business model with increased geographic reach potential which places the Group at the forefront in supporting the increasing requirement for systems and technologies underpinning high performing and scalable primary food production. 
 
The Group’s strategic relationships with leading global suppliers of feed ingredients, crop protection and nutrition confers substantial sourcing benefits that are increasingly important in an environment of significantly greater volatility.
 
In Ireland the Feed Ingredients and Fertiliser businesses delivered a very satisfactory performance. Volume growth underpinned by stable livestock numbers drove the performance in feed. Fertiliser also delivered a strong performance against the background of higher prices driving an overall reduction in usage.
 
The Group’s UK fertiliser business achieved volume growth on the back of higher application rates in the arable sector as farmers sought to maximise yields and benefit from higher output prices. Increased worldwide demand for fertiliser led to tighter supplies and the business delivered an excellent performance supported by its strategically located distribution facilities and very strong operational capability.
 
In February 2008, Origin acquired Masstock Group Holdings Limited (‘Masstock’), the leading provider of integrated agronomy and farming systems advisory services to arable and grassland farm enterprises across the United Kingdom and Poland. Masstock delivers prescription solutions providing farmers with the optimum combinations of crop varietal selection, cultivation systems, crop nutrition and protection designed to maximise quality and yield. This competence is underpinned by Masstock’s advanced technical research based system in partnership with global manufacturers of seed, nutrition and crop protection.  
 
The acquisition of Masstock represents an exceptional strategic fit with our existing Agri-Nutrition business and Masstock delivered an excellent contribution in the seasonally important second half of the financial year driven by increased cereal acreage.
 
In July 2008, Origin acquired a 20 per cent interest in Continental Farmers Group plc (‘Continental Farmers’). Continental Farmers is a large scale producer of high value arable crops that has built a successful farming business in the Vistula Delta area of Northern Poland over the past 14 years. In 2006, Continental Farmers commenced the development of an intensive arable farming operation in the L’Viv region of Western Ukraine. Continental Farmers land holding currently comprises 2,500 hectares (‘ha’) in Poland and over 18,000 ha in Ukraine. Origin will actively support the growth and development of Continental Farmers through the provision of input sourcing programmes and agronomy expertise.
 
Marine Proteins delivered a satisfactory performance against the background of lower price realisations for fishmeal and reduced raw material intake. The business continues to benefit from growth in aquaculture and is also benefiting from higher inclusion levels of fishmeal in pig and poultry diets.
 
Pressure on raw material availability combined with higher landing and conversion costs present a compelling case for industry consolidation. Origin is ideally positioned to lead and support a consolidation initiative as the largest producer of fishmeal and fish oil in Ireland and the UK and third largest in Europe. Discussions which commenced earlier in the year with Austevoll Seafood ASA with a view to combining our respective fishmeal and fish oil operations in Europe are ongoing.

Food delivered a very satisfactory performance during 2008 with the Group’s brands maintaining their strong market positions and achieving good underlying sales growth. One of the key features of the year was the significant increase in raw material prices experienced across a number of categories.
 
The Shamrock and Roma brands achieved excellent sales growth in the year reflecting continuing momentum through category and channel extension. The Shamrock Just brand proved very successful in the healthy snacking market, gaining increased distribution. Roma’s extension into Mediterranean food ingredients combined with a renewed focus and rebranding of Roma Organics, resulted in increased distribution driving strong underlying sales growth. Foodservice had an excellent year increasing its presence in a number of new channels and the agency business continued to perform well. The businesses were successful in recovering significant input cost inflation during the year.
 
Odlums, Ireland’s premier cereal miller, delivered a satisfactory performance in the period. The business experienced a challenging first half relating to the timing of the implementation of price increases reflecting higher raw material costs which were fully implemented from the start of the second half of the financial year. Key sales, marketing and distribution activities were integrated into Shamrock Foods during the year resulting in improved customer service levels and streamlined distribution.
 
Odlums, Shamrock and Roma are market leading brands across the home baking, snacking and ambient Italian food ingredients categories. This complementary product range is now supported by a focussed sales, marketing, distribution and product development capability enabling the Group to capitalise on the key characteristics demanded by today’s consumers for quality, healthy and natural products. 
 
 
 
Property
 
The Group's major property asset comprises its interest in the Cork South Docks. Following the acquisition of Odlums this now comprises a 32 acre footprint with prime water frontage. 
 
After extensive consultation the Cork South Docks Local Area Plan ('SDLAP') was formally adopted by Cork City Council in February 2008. The SDLAP provides greater certainty on the extent and timing of development and Origin supports the recommendations set out in the plan.
 
Following the adoption of the SDLAP Origin submitted a detailed Masterplan for its entire 32 acre footprint. A planning application for the Group’s first two acre riverfront site at the apex of the docks was submitted in June 2008. This planning application is for buildings with an aggregate area of 51,000 sq. metres comprising a mixture of retail, office and residential space.
 
We will continue to advance our objective of maximising the marketability of our surplus property assets over the medium term.

About Origin Enterprises plc
 
Origin Enterprises plc is a leading Agri-Nutrition and Food company listed on the IEX and AIM markets of the Irish and London Stock Exchanges. The Agri-Nutrition division, through its manufacturing and distribution operations in Ireland, the United Kingdom and Poland, has leading market positions in the supply of feed ingredients, specialist agronomy services, crop nutrition and marine proteins. The Group's Food division, comprising sales, marketing, distribution and manufacturing activities in Ireland, has leadership positions in ambient food across the retail, food service and manufacturing sectors.
